有没有办法在重新加载时保存画布的状态?



我正在使用node js来构建一个虚拟白板,其中2个或更多客户端可以使用套接字在板上写入。IO 模块。

对于电路板,我使用了p5.js。 有没有办法保存画布(板(的状态。每当客户端重新加载页面时,都会清除板的内容。我不希望这种情况发生。 以及如何做到这一点的想法?

如果您认为将此数据存储在浏览器中没有问题,可以尝试使用Window.localStorage. 请参阅 https://developer.mozilla.org/en-US/docs/Web/API/Window/localStorage

否则,您必须将其存储在服务器中。 好吧,无论如何,如果您应该长期保存数据,您将不得不偶尔存储在数据库中。

另外,请记住,Window.localStorage仅适用于"每个浏览器"方法。我的意思是,例如,数据不会在不同设备之间共享。因此,也许考虑同时使用两者是个好主意。

相关内容

  • 没有找到相关文章